Output 2811ac688b7e70fa201aacbc57bc2867efcedda44dc86c12bb1a3d838a832e72:2

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85203995fedadcfbd43c03423c3cfe64d9573991 OP_EQUAL
address
3DpvQ5vKJLsAwyPWDPowAEPaXCJ9saRnBG
transaction
2811ac688b7e70fa201aacbc57bc2867efcedda44dc86c12bb1a3d838a832e72
confirmations
139229
spent
true